MISION II launched in Africa
09. December 2009
MISION II launched its activities in Africa in July 2009 through a pilot program in Senegal. The objective of this one year pilot phase is to support 4 Senegalese MFIs (Caurie MF-AMT Member, U-IMCEC, ASACASE, FDEA) to develop their social performance management system ... more
AMT member PAWDEP becomes first Kenyan MFI to report to MFTransparency
10. November 2009
AMT is pleased to learn that one of its members, PAWDEP, is the first Kenyan MFI to submit its data to the MFTransparency Transparent Pricing Initiative.
Not only is PAWDEP the first MFI in Kenya to become a member of this initiative, but this marks the first African microfinance service ... more
2 AMT members awarded for reporting their social performance
09. November 2009
Both Enda Inter Arabe from Tunisia and ID Ghana were awarded the Silver Certificate Award for their reporting on their social performance.
To date, over 200 MFIs have completed the SPTF/MIX Social Performance Standards Report. Awards for successful reporting on the set of social performance ... more
